User experience evaluation of a 3D virtual reality educational program for illegal drug use prevention among high school students: Applying the decomposed theory of planned behavior.

Abstract

OBJECTIVE

To evaluate user acceptability of an immersive three-dimensional virtual reality program for preventing illegal drug use and identify factors associated with continuous usage intention of three-dimensional virtual reality learning among high school students based on the decomposed theory of planned behavior.

METHODS

In this cross-sectional observational study, we developed five educational modules and serious games based on three-dimensional virtual reality technology. Ninety student-participants' experiences were assessed by a structured questionnaire based on the decomposed theory of planned behavior variables. We applied partial least squares structural equation modeling to examine the correlates of continuous usage intention.

RESULTS

The proposed model demonstrated an acceptable fit to the observed data. Eight of the 11 hypotheses based on the decomposed theory of planned behavior were supported. Continuous usage intention was significantly associated with attitudes, subjective norms, and perceived behavioral control; these variables explained 55.4% of the variance in continuous usage intention. Perceived usefulness and compatibility were significant antecedents of attitude. The significant antecedent of subjective norms was support from school staff. Self-efficacy and resource-facilitating conditions were significant antecedents of perceived behavioral control.

CONCLUSIONS

Our findings support the applicability of the decomposed theory of planned behavior as a framework for evaluating a three-dimensional virtual reality program for illegal drug use. We recommend that the program be included as teaching material for illegal drug prevention education in senior high schools.

摘要

目的

基于计划行为分解理论,评估一款用于预防非法药物使用的沉浸式三维虚拟现实程序的用户可接受性,并确定与高中生三维虚拟现实学习持续使用意愿相关的因素。

方法

在这项横断面观察性研究中,我们基于三维虚拟现实技术开发了五个教育模块和严肃游戏。通过一份基于计划行为分解理论变量的结构化问卷,对90名学生参与者的体验进行了评估。我们应用偏最小二乘结构方程模型来检验持续使用意愿的相关因素。

结果

所提出的模型与观测数据拟合良好。基于计划行为分解理论的11个假设中有8个得到支持。持续使用意愿与态度、主观规范和感知行为控制显著相关;这些变量解释了持续使用意愿中55.4%的方差变异。感知有用性和兼容性是态度的重要前因。主观规范的重要前因是学校工作人员的支持。自我效能感和资源促进条件是感知行为控制的重要前因。

结论

我们的研究结果支持计划行为分解理论作为评估用于预防非法药物使用的三维虚拟现实程序框架的适用性。我们建议将该程序纳入高中非法药物预防教育的教材中。
